Career Choices Dewis Gyrfa Ltd is looking for an Electrical Fitter to join their team in Merthyr Tydfil, offering a salary between £32,000 and £34,000. This full-time, permanent position involves the installation and integration of electrical systems in a production environment.
Candidates should have an apprenticeship in Electrical Engineering and relevant experience in a manufacturing setting. The role starts in July 2026 and requires a strong focus on safety and quality.

How to prepare for a job interview at Career Choices Dewis Gyrfa Ltd
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your electrical engineering principles and the specifics of precision wiring and assembly. Familiarise yourself with common safety protocols and quality standards in a manufacturing environment, as these will likely come up during the interview.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are to discuss your apprenticeship and any relevant experience in detail. Think of specific projects or tasks you've completed that demonstrate your skills in installation and integration of electrical systems. Real-life examples will make your answers more compelling.
✨Safety First
Since the role emphasises safety, be ready to talk about how you prioritise safety in your work. Share any experiences where you identified potential hazards or implemented safety measures, showing that you take this aspect seriously.
✨Ask Smart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ask insightful questions about the company’s approach to quality and safety in their production processes.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
